Ingredients:

  • 1 can (14 oz) sweetened condensed milk
  • 1/2 cup unsalted butter, melted
  • 1 cup brown sugar, packed
  • 1 tsp vanilla extract
  • 2 cups chopped pecans
  • 1 box (15.25 oz) yellow cake mix
  • 1/2 cup unsalted butter, melted

Instructions:

  1.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C).
  2. In a 9x13 inch baking pan, stir together the sweetened condensed milk, first 1/2 cup of melted butter, brown sugar, and vanilla until smooth.
  3. Fold in the chopped pecans until they are evenly coated in the syrup.
  4. Evenly sprinkle the dry yellow cake mix over the pecan mixture without stirring.
  5. Drizzle the remaining 1/2 cup of melted butter evenly over the cake mix, using a spatula to gently push the butter into any dry pockets.
  6. Bake uncovered for 20 minutes.
  7. Cover the pan loosely with aluminum foil and bake for another 15-20 minutes.
  8. Remove the foil for the final 5 minutes of baking to ensure the top is golden brown.
